Job Summary
The Accountant plays a foundational role in that mission, delivering the accurate, timely financial data that enables OpenGov to grow and serve the public sector with integrity. Reporting to the Accounting Manager and based four days per week in our Chicago office, this role executes key GL accounting activities across monthly, quarterly, and annual close cycles while partnering with FP&A and operations to keep our financial reporting sharp and reliable.
Responsibilities
Execute general ledger accounting for assigned areas — including accruals, fixed assets, leases, prepaids, and intangibles — by recording journal entries, preparing reconciliations, and supporting variance analyses
Contribute to monthly, quarterly, and annual close activities by completing assigned deliverables on time and within established procedures
Partner with FP&A and cross-functional teams to gather information, resolve discrepancies, and support accurate and timely financial reporting
Assist with external audit preparation by compiling supporting documentation and responding to auditor requests within assigned areas
Support the maintenance of accounting policies and procedures, and surface ideas for workflow improvements within your area of ownership
Research accounting guidance on assigned topics and prepare supporting documentation for manager review
Requirements and Preferred Experience
Requirements
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, or a related field, or equivalent work experience
1+ years of accounting experience in a public accounting or industry setting
Foundational knowledge of US GAAP, financial statements, and core accounting principles
Proficiency in Microsoft Excel and related products
Strong attention to detail and organizational skills, with the ability to manage multiple tasks within a close cycle
Clear written and verbal communication skills; comfortable working cross-functionally with finance and non-finance stakeholders
Comfortable using AI-native tools to accelerate accounting workflows, improve efficiency, and support data analysis
Preferred Experience
Experience with NetSuite or a similar cloud-based ERP system
Exposure to accruals, fixed assets, prepaids, or lease accounting
CPA candidate status or active pursuit of CPA certification
Background in a SaaS, technology, or high-growth company environment
Familiarity with government technology or the public sector
